The fifth edition of the CJ Cup is beginning tomorrow at the Summit Club, Summerlin. Big names are in attendance, including Dustin Johnson, Collin Morikawa, and Sung-jae Im. Justin Thomas, the two-time winner of the tournament, will also be playing.
The cup, which is generally played at the Nine Bridges in Jeju Island, was postponed due to the pandemic travel restrictions. Hence, for two consecutive years now, since 2020, Vegas has hosted the PGA Tour event.

Moreover, in a press conference prior to the first round, JT, as he is usually called, learned that he has another nickname. As revealed, the Korean audience calls him ‘The Icon’.

The Korean fans have a new nickname for Justin Thomas
A day before the start of the competition, Thomas appeared at a press conference. “You’re making your fifth start at the CJ Cup, with two wins. I was just told that you have a nickname in Korea, that you are ‘The Icon’,” said a journalist. Unquestionably, it’s a fitting name for the 2017 and 2019 winner.

With a grin, JT replies “That’s a cool nickname! I didn’t know that.” Moreover, he was asked what this tournament meant to him. He went on to express his love, not only for the tournament but also for Jeju island, where the first three editions were hosted.

“I mean, obviously I wish you know, we could be spending this time in Jeju island. I have a lot of great memories there. Developed a lot of great friendships and relationships. I mean it’s a cool place, and golf is so unique that we’re able to travel the world and go to different places,” he said.
“It’s a great week. The golf course, the food, the hotel. Obviously, the travel’s a little bit easier this week; just coming to Vegas versus Jeju. But, yeah, it’s a great tournament, and it’s great to see a lot of familiar faces and hopefully, we can recreate some of the good memories here in Vegas.”
